The VJS legacy system (algus$.startup) uses HTTP Basic Auth via the nvagun DAD — which has no sign-out button. Clearing cookies doesn't help because Basic Auth credentials are cached in browser memory, not cookies.
This bookmarklet forces the browser to forget the cached credentials.

From: framework-research team (Aeneas / Mihkel) Purpose: Establish a bidirectional comms bridge between framework-research (FR) and hr-devs teams via the ghost-bridge daemon.
The ghost-bridge daemon polls inbox files over SSH every 2 seconds. Each team has a "ghost member" — a comm endpoint with no running agent. When FR's team-lead calls SendMessage(to="hr-devs-lead-ghost"), the daemon picks it up and SSH-appends it to your team-lead inbox. And vice versa.
The bridge runs on the FR side (Windows dev machine → SSH to dev@100.96.54.170:22).
